Movements
The symphony is divided into four movements with the following tempo markings:
- Allegro non troppo (E minor)
- Andante moderato (E major)
- Allegro giocoso (C major)
- Allegro energico e passionato (E minor)
A typical performance lasts about 40 minutes.
